However I don't think this was the main part of the joke, rather it's that lateral transistors are _way_ worse in pretty much every conceivable metric than vertical transistors save two - they are hard to destroy and cheap. So add 'lateral' to 'PNP' and you basically have 'worst possible transistor', so bad that you can't kill it.
